A. Electropolishing does not necessarily involve complex proprietary solutions, although those are available too. Simple chemicals like high concentration sulfuric and/or phosphoric acids can be used, but they are not necessarily "safe". See Durney's Electroplating Engineering Handbook ⇦ this on eBay, AbeBooks, or Amazon [affil link] for a good compilation of the various formulations.
If you can't get basic industrial chemicals like these acids, you're probably out of luck.

A. There are thousands of variations of mixtures and temperatures for electropolishing SS. There also is no single formulation that will work best for all SS. I would quite strongly recommend that you buy or rent a very good book on the subject before investing in acids , tanks, racks, lab equipment and power supplies. Ted's book recommendation is a beginning only. Try a search for electropolishing and Faust. Faust had several in depth publications and magazine articles, but they are like 20 years old.
